What's The Definition Of Distress call?

distress call in American English
noun: a prearranged communication code sign indicating that the sender is in a situation of peril, distress, or the like, as SOS, Mayday, etc

distress call in British English
noun: a call to authorities notifying them of a person, vehicle or vessel requiring emergency services
